Visualize Scene Options
 
Visualize scene options (scene states and animation sequences) by displaying them as entities in 3D world for easier and practical VR experiences.
 
 
 
Press "3" on your keyboard in VR Viewer to show available Pins, "LBUTTON" to select Scene States/Animation Sequences which appear as entities from the Pins.

  • To use Visualize Scene Options feature, Follow the steps below:
 
1. Open the SimLab Composer.
 
2. Create multiple Scene States/Animation Sequence (Create at least two).
 
3. From Interactions menu click Visualize Scene Options.
 
4. Select the object for which to make a list, Ex: Bedside Table, select the table model then Add a Trigger by click 
 
5. The object name (Bedside Table) should appear in the Pin and Scene Options side as shown in image below.
                                                                  
6. Now drag and drop Scene States/Animation Sequence (created in step two) from Scene States Library into the VR List1 one by one.
                    
 
7. The Scene States/Animation Sequence will appear under the VR List1 as shown in image below.
                                                       
 
8. Change the name of list and choose the shapes to display Scene States/Animation Sequences in VR Viewer from List Properties when click
                                           
 
9. When done, click Save
